San Diego
A 24-year-old San Diego man was shot to death early Monday in the 4300 block of Bancroft Street. Police found Jose Angel Osuna, a native of Mexico, seriously wounded after they were called at 4:40 a.m. to investigate reports of gunshots.
After administering first aid, police rushed Osuna to Mercy Hospital, where he died shortly after arrival. Osuna was a transvestite, police spokesman Bill Robinson said. He said the police have no one in custody and are continuing to investigate.
